Understanding Your Skin Type

The first step to effective Skincare and Facials at Home in Dubai is identifying your skin type. This will help you choose the right products and tailor your routine accordingly. Common skin types include:

  • Normal: Balanced oil production, not overly oily or dry.
  • Dry: Lacks moisture, and often feels tight and flaky.
  • Oily: Produces excess oil, leading to shine and breakouts.
  • Combination: A mix of oily and dry areas, typically oily in the T-zone (forehead, nose, and chin) and dry on the cheeks.
  • Sensitive: Prone to redness, irritation, and allergic reactions.

Understanding the Aging Process

The aging Skincare and Facials at Home in Dubai process is influenced by a combination of factors, including genetics, lifestyle, and environmental stressors. As we get older, our skin cells regenerate more slowly, leading to decreased collagen and elastin production. This loss of structural proteins results in wrinkles, sagging skin, and a dull complexion. Additionally, sun exposure, pollution, and hormonal changes can accelerate the aging process.

How to Determine Your Skin Type

Determining your skin type is relatively simple. After washing your face with a gentle cleanser, wait for about an hour without applying any products. Observe how your skin feels:

  • Dry Skin: If your skin feels tight or looks flaky, you likely have dry skin.
  • Oily Skin: If your skin appears shiny, especially in the T-zone (forehead, nose, and chin), you likely have oily skin.
  • Combination Skin: If you experience both dryness and oiliness in different areas, you have combination skin.
  • Sensitive Skin: If your skin easily becomes red or irritated, you have sensitive skin.

Once you’ve identified your skin type, you can select ingredients and facial treatments that will best address your skin’s needs.

Choosing the Right Ingredients

One of the best aspects of DIY facials is the ability to use natural, readily available ingredients. You don’t need expensive products to achieve glowing skin; many beneficial ingredients can be found right in your kitchen. Here are some popular DIY facial ingredients and their benefits:

Natural Ingredients for DIY Facials

  • Honey: Known for its moisturizing and antibacterial properties, honey is an excellent choice for hydrating and soothing the skin. It’s particularly beneficial for dry or sensitive skin types.

  • Yogurt: Rich in lactic acid, yogurt helps exfoliate and brighten the skin. It can also calm irritated skin and reduce redness.

  • Oatmeal: A gentle exfoliant, oatmeal is ideal for sensitive skin. It helps to soothe irritation and provides a natural glow.

  • Avocado: Packed with healthy fats and vitamins, avocado is great for nourishing and moisturizing dry skin.

  • Clay: Different types of clay (such as bentonite or kaolin) can be used to absorb excess oil and detoxify the skin, making them ideal for oily or acne-prone skin.

Understanding Acne and Its Causes

Let's delve into Skincare and Facials at Home in Dubai. Acne is a common skin condition that can be triggered by a variety of factors. From hormonal changes and excessive oil production to clogged pores and bacteria, acne can manifest in numerous ways. Understanding these causes is crucial in tackling the problem effectively. Hormonal fluctuations, particularly during puberty, menstruation, or pregnancy, can lead to increased oil production and breakouts. Additionally, factors like stress, diet, and improper skincare habits can exacerbate the condition.

1. Cleansing

The first step in any skincare routine is proper cleansing. Use a gentle, sulfate-free cleanser designed for acne-prone skin. Cleansing twice a day, morning and night, helps remove excess oil, dirt, and impurities that can clog pores and contribute to breakouts. Look for cleansers containing ingredients like salicylic acid or benzoyl peroxide, which help to exfoliate dead skin cells and reduce inflammation.

2. Exfoliation

Exfoliating your skin is essential for removing dead skin cells that can clog pores and lead to acne. Opt for chemical exfoliants containing alpha hydroxy acids (AHAs) or beta hydroxy acids (BHAs). These exfoliants help to dissolve the bonds between dead skin cells, making it easier for your skin to shed them naturally. Avoid physical exfoliants with rough particles, as they can irritate the skin and worsen acne.

3. Toning

Toning helps to balance the skin’s pH levels and tighten pores. Choose a toner with calming ingredients like witch hazel or rose water, which can soothe inflammation and reduce redness. Avoid toners with high alcohol content, as they can strip the skin of its natural oils and exacerbate dryness, leading to further breakouts.

4. Moisturizing

Even oily skin needs moisture. Use a lightweight, non-comedogenic moisturizer that won’t clog pores. Look for products labeled as “oil-free” or “gel-based” to provide hydration without adding excess oil. Moisturizing helps maintain the skin’s barrier function, preventing it from becoming too dry and triggering increased oil production.

Essential Steps for a Successful At-Home Facial

To achieve the best results from your at-home facial, follow these essential steps:

1. Cleansing

Cleansing is the first and most crucial step in any skincare routine. Start by removing any makeup, dirt, and impurities from your skin. Use a gentle cleanser suited to your skin type. For an added boost, consider double cleansing—first with an oil-based cleanser to dissolve makeup and then with a water-based cleanser to remove any remaining residue.

Skincare and Facials at Home in Dubai

2. Exfoliation

Exfoliation helps to remove dead skin cells and promote cell turnover, revealing a brighter complexion. You can choose between physical exfoliants (scrubs) and chemical exfoliants (like alpha-hydroxy acids or beta-hydroxy acids). Physical exfoliants should be used gently to avoid irritation, while chemical exfoliants can offer deeper penetration and more even results. Exfoliate once or twice a week, depending on your skin’s sensitivity and needs.

3. Steam

Steaming your face opens up your pores, allowing for deeper cleansing and better absorption of subsequent products. To steam your face at home, boil water and pour it into a bowl. Hold your face over the bowl at a safe distance and cover your head with a towel to trap the steam. Steam for about 5-10 minutes, making sure to avoid getting too close to the hot water.

4. Mask

Applying a facial mask is a key component of an effective at-home facial. Choose a mask based on your skin type and concerns. Clay masks are excellent for oily and acne-prone skin, while hydrating masks are ideal for dry or sensitive skin. Apply the mask evenly over your face, avoiding the eye area, and leave it on for the recommended time before rinsing off with lukewarm water.

5. Toning

Toning helps to restore the skin's natural pH balance and prepare it for better absorption of serums and moisturizers. Use a toner that suits your skin type—hydrating toners for dry skin, and astringent toners for oily skin. Apply the toner using a cotton pad or by gently patting it into your skin with your hands.

6. Serum

Serums are concentrated treatments designed to address specific skin issues such as wrinkles, dark spots, or uneven texture. Choose a serum with active ingredients tailored to your skin concerns, such as hyaluronic acid for hydration or vitamin C for brightening. Apply the serum evenly across your face and neck, allowing it to fully absorb before moving on to the next step.

7. Moisturizing

Moisturizing is essential to keep your skin hydrated and maintain its barrier function. Choose a moisturizer appropriate for your skin type—light, oil-free formulas for oily skin, and rich, emollient creams for dry skin. Apply the moisturizer in upward strokes, ensuring that it is well absorbed.

8. Sun Protection

If you perform your at-home facial in the morning, don’t forget to apply sunscreen as the final step in your routine. Sunscreen protects your skin from harmful UV rays that can cause premature aging and skin damage. Use a broad-spectrum SPF of at least 30 and apply it generously to all exposed areas.

Understanding the Importance of Exfoliation

Exfoliation is the process of removing dead skin cells from the surface of your skin. Over time, these cells accumulate, leading to dullness, clogged pores, and an uneven skin texture. Regular exfoliation not only brightens your complexion but also allows your skincare products to penetrate more deeply, enhancing their effectiveness.

Understanding Oily Skin

Before diving into Skincare and Facials at Home in Dubai control methods, it’s important to understand why your skin might be oily. Oily skin is primarily caused by overactive sebaceous glands, which produce excess sebum (oil). This can be due to a variety of factors, including genetics, hormonal changes, diet, and even the environment. While some oil is necessary to keep your skin moisturized and protected, too much can lead to clogged pores, acne, and a shiny complexion.

Understanding Sensitive Skin

Sensitive skin is a common condition where the skin reacts more strongly to various factors, including environmental changes, skincare products, and even stress. This heightened reactivity often leads to symptoms such as redness, itching, burning, and dryness. Understanding the triggers of your sensitive skin is the first step towards managing and soothing it effectively.

People with sensitive skin often have a weakened skin barrier, making it more prone to irritation and inflammation. Therefore, it’s essential to choose gentle, soothing products that help restore and maintain the skin’s natural barrier function.
